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
950 3214600 1668992029 3407183444
92 41895
92 41895
38 67718873 288 51669178520
All about undefined
Interested in learning more?
92 41895
38 67718873 288 51669178520
See more
94012206 30448521 4529044
075017831 61 839 950 100254
See more
68429 9060325736 21043
584053 8508420 4212
See more